Louis Vuitton — Industrial Controller Intern in Barberà del Vallès, Spain. Intern to support management control, inventory and reporting using SAP, Excel and Power BI.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Support the management control system and related reporting processes.
  • Contribute to productivity growth and continuous process improvement initiatives.
  • Participate in monthly and annual financial closings to ensure reliability of reports.
  • Analyse and prepare key financial and operational KPIs and optimise report generation.
  • Assist with stock, materials control and inventory management at the Atelier.

Qualifications

  • University degree in Industrial Engineering or a closely related discipline (or current enrolment).
  • Proficiency with SAP, Microsoft Excel and Power BI.
  • Working knowledge of French and/or English.
  • Availability to work on-site at the Barberà del Vallès Atelier and flexibility to accommodate study timetables.
